What are the Pros and Cons of obtaining an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ree vs On Campus?

Deciding between an online or on-campus Information Systems and Technology bachelor's degree? It's a big decision, and it helps to weigh the pros and cons of each to find what suits you best. Let's dive in.

Pros of an Online Degree

  • Flexibility: You can study anytime, anywhere. This is perfect if you're juggling work, family, or other commitments.
  • Cost-Effectiveness: Generally, online programs can be less expensive. You save on commuting, campus fees, and sometimes even on tuition costs.
  • Tech-Savvy Environment: As an IT student, working in an online environment can sharpen your digital communication and remote collaboration skills—key competencies in today's job market.
  • Self-Paced Learning: Many online programs offer asynchronous classes, allowing you to learn at your own pace and schedule.
  • Broader Network: Connect with classmates and instructors from across the globe, enriching your educational experience with diverse perspectives.

Cons of an Online Degree

  • Lack of In-Person Interaction: Missing out on face-to-face interaction can affect networking opportunities and may lead to feelings of isolation.
  • Self-Discipline Required: Without the structure of a physical classroom, staying motivated and on top of assignments can be challenging.
  • Technology Dependence: A reliable internet connection and a suitable device are must-haves. Technical issues can disrupt your learning experience.
  • Perception Issues: Although it's changing, some employers may still favor a traditional on-campus degree over an online one.
  • Limited Campus Experience: The college experience isn't just about academics. Online students might miss out on extracurricular activities, facilities, and social aspects of campus life.

Pros of an On-Campus Degree

  • Networking Opportunities: Face-to-face interactions with peers and professors can lead to lifelong friendships and professional connections.
  • Structured Environment: Regular class schedules provide a routine that can help keep you disciplined and focused.
  • Access to Campus Resources: Libraries, labs, sports facilities, and student services—all at your fingertips.
  • Hands-On Learning: Certain courses might offer more hands-on learning opportunities in a physical classroom or lab setting.
  • College Experience: From clubs to sports games, living on campus offers a wealth of experiences beyond the classroom.

Cons of an On-Campus Degree

  • Higher Costs: Beyond tuition, costs for housing, meals, transportation, and campus fees can add up quickly.
  • Less Flexibility: Fixed class schedules mean less freedom to work or manage personal responsibilities.
  • Commuting Time: Traveling to and from campus can be time-consuming, tiring, and expensive.
  • Limited Geographic Options: You might be confined to choosing schools within a certain distance from home or face relocating.
  • Potential for Distraction: Campus life is vibrant but can sometimes divert attention away from academic goals.

Choosing between an online or on-campus Information Systems and Technology bachelor's degree depends on your lifestyle, learning preferences, and career goals. Both paths offer unique advantages and challenges. Consider what matters most to you in your educational journey and career aspirations as you make your decision.

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ree FAQs

What Can I Expect to Learn in an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ree Program?

In an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ree program, you're set to gain a comprehensive understanding of both the technical and business aspects of information systems. Here’s a snapshot of what your learning journey will cover:

  • Core Principles of Information Technology: Delve into the basics of computer science, programming languages, and software development.
  • Systems Analysis and Design: Learn how to assess organizational needs and design information systems to meet those requirements.
  • Database Management: Gain expertise in managing databases, including SQL programming, data modeling, and database design.
  • Network and Security: Understand the essentials of network architecture, cloud computing, and cybersecurity practices to protect data.
  • Project Management: Acquire skills in managing technology projects, including planning, execution, and team leadership.

How Long Does It Take to Complete an Online Bachelor's in Information Systems and Technology?

The duration of your program can vary based on several factors:

  • Full-time vs. Part-time Enrollment: Full-time students can typically complete their degree in about 4 years. Part-time students may take longer, depending on how many courses they take per term.
  • Transfer Credits: If you're transferring credits from previous college coursework, you might be able to shorten the length of your program significantly.
  • Accelerated Programs: Some schools offer accelerated options allowing you to complete your degree in less time, sometimes as little as 2-3 years.

Are There Any Prerequisites for Enrolling in an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ree Program?

While specific prerequisites can vary by program, here are some common requirements you might encounter:

  • High School Diploma or GED: This is a fundamental requirement for most undergraduate programs.
  • Mathematics Proficiency: Given the technical nature of the curriculum, some programs may require a background in mathematics or related subjects.
  • Technical Skills: Basic computer literacy and familiarity with the internet are often expected since the program is delivered online.

Can I Specialize Within an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ree Program?

Yes, many programs offer specializations or concentrations that allow you to focus on a specific area within information systems and technology. Common specializations include:

  • Cybersecurity
  • Data Analytics
  • Software Development
  • Cloud Computing
  • Health Information Systems

Specializing can help you tailor your education to your career goals and interests.

What Technical Requirements Do I Need to Meet for an Online Program?

To ensure a smooth online learning experience, you’ll need:

  • A reliable internet connection
  • A computer with sufficient processing power and memory
  • Specific software applications as required by your program (e.g., development environments for coding courses)
  • Sometimes, a webcam and microphone for participating in live sessions or recordings

Always check with your chosen program for a detailed list of technical requirements.

How Do I Choose the Right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ree Program?

Selecting the right program involves considering several key factors:

  • Accreditation: Ensure the program is accredited by a recognized accrediting agency. This guarantees that the program meets certain educational standards.
  • Curriculum: Look for a curriculum that aligns with your career goals. Review course descriptions to see if they match what you want to learn.
  • Flexibility: If you have other commitments, consider programs that offer asynchronous classes or flexible scheduling options.
  • Support Services: Investigate what student support services are available, such as tutoring, career services, and technical support.
  • Cost: Consider tuition costs and available financial aid options. Don’t forget to factor in any additional fees that may apply.

Taking the time to research and compare programs will help ensure you choose one that best fits your needs and goals.

Is an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ree Worth It?

In today's fast-paced and ever-evolving job market, the decision to pursue higher education, especially in a field as dynamic as information systems and technology, warrants a thorough evaluation. If you're contemplating whether an online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ree is the right step for your career, consider the following aspects to guide your decision.

Job Market Demand

  • Growing Field: The demand for professionals skilled in information systems and technology is projected to grow significantly in the coming years. Businesses and organizations across various sectors rely on technology for operational efficiency, making this field resilient to economic downturns.
  • Versatile Career Paths: Graduates can pursue a wide range of careers, including but not limited to, systems analyst, IT manager, cybersecurity analyst, network architect, and software developer.
  • Competitive Salaries: Careers in information systems and technology are known for their lucrative pay. The investment in an online bachelor's degree often pays off with higher starting salaries and greater earning potential over time.

Flexibility and Accessibility

  • Convenience: An online degree program offers the flexibility to balance your studies with work or personal commitments. This is particularly beneficial for those who are already employed or cannot commit to a traditional on-campus program.
  • Broader Access to Top Programs: Geographic location is no longer a barrier. You have the opportunity to enroll in highly regarded programs across the country without the need to relocate.

Skill Development

  • Technical Proficiency: The curriculum is designed to equip students with the latest skills and knowledge in information systems and technology. This includes programming, database management, network architecture, and cybersecurity.
  • Soft Skills: Beyond technical expertise, students develop critical soft skills such as problem-solving, analytical thinking, and effective communication. These skills are highly valued by employers across all industries.

Cost-Effectiveness

  • Lower Overall Expenses: Online programs often come with lower tuition fees compared to their on-campus counterparts. Additionally, you save on commuting, housing, and other associated costs of on-campus learning.
  • Return on Investment: Given the high demand and competitive salaries in the field of information systems and technology, the return on investment for obtaining an online bachelor's degree can be substantial.

Networking Opportunities

  • Diverse Professional Network: Online programs often attract students from various locations and professional backgrounds. This diversity enriches the learning experience and expands your professional network.
  • Alumni Connections: Many programs offer access to alumni networks that can provide valuable mentorship opportunities and connections within the industry.

In summary, obtaining an Online Information Systems and Technology Bachelor's Degree is a worthwhile investment for those looking to advance or start their career in this thriving field. The combination of job market demand, flexibility, skill development, cost-effectiveness, and networking opportunities makes it an attractive option for many prospective students.
